ANTON MUSSERT - N.S.B. DUTCH PROPAGANDA POSTER
Scarce ca. January, 1943 Dutch N.S.B. propaganda poster, 14 1/2" x 21" (sight) picturing Dutch National Socialist Movement (NSB) founder Anton Mussert at center in a black shirt, tie and tunic with party patch on his sleeve. The caption reads:"Support, all good Netherlanders, Mussert in his difficult march NOW 'I am Dutch in heart and soul, and whoever wants to destroy this country, will find me his greatest enemy' Mussert 8-4-41". Light folds, else very good, matted and nicely framed. Mussert was executed for treason at war's end.
